Skillet Tips

Skillet meals are a great way to get so much flavor because all of the ingredients are cooked together in a pan! Here are a few tips that are good to know, especially if you haven’t cooked a lot in a skillet before! Good luck and enjoy!

  • How to clean a skillet: You never want to put your skillet pan in the dishwasher! This will eat away at the coating. You can use mild soap and hand wash it.
  • Preheat your pan: When you are cooking with a skillet, you want to take the time to heat it up on the stove before adding ingredients. This will help so that your food doesn’t stick to it. start it out on low heat and then gradually move it up to medium and then high. Heat it up for about 5 minutes before you want to use it for cooking your skillet meals!
  • Dry your pan: Skillets can rust very easily (which is bad!) so make sure that after you cook with it or clean it, you dry it off all the way!
